)]}'
{
  "commit": "e7ab5b9457b63af9c71201416ad388d58beaf48d",
  "tree": "87534ad65ccc3ba0374eff33af230e40cae813de",
  "parents": [
    "af2297488daf637e4f285d216656226b840b9026"
  ],
  "author": {
    "name": "donNewtonAlpha",
    "email": "donNewtonAlpha@gmail.com",
    "time": "Thu Sep 27 15:09:14 2018 -0400"
  },
  "committer": {
    "name": "donNewtonAlpha",
    "email": "donNewtonAlpha@gmail.com",
    "time": "Thu Sep 27 15:25:50 2018 -0400"
  },
  "message": "SEBA-261\nrefactor to support serialize/deserialize\n\nChange-Id: Icdc0bc2bb06a9d1c3240c0f46e1de02953a0b017\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"c4fd8f3f3bccb8d4b39dc9f13ebd32e01ad5b08f",
      "old_mode": 33188,
      "old_path": "Makefile",
      "new_id": "a0e9b5c6e85c33f0c334fe7637a385b6b7797c66",
      "new_mode": 33188,
      "new_path": "Makefile"
    },
    {
      "type": "modify",
      "old_id": "fb4aee749f47ea2d1d7d04aa8452491288f5d5a7",
      "old_mode": 33188,
      "old_path": "api/abstract_olt_api.proto",
      "new_id": "6604703ebce3d6f2754cb7653fe1afdd5844f713",
      "new_mode": 33188,
      "new_path": "api/abstract_olt_api.proto"
    },
    {
      "type": "modify",
      "old_id": "54115a620289e87c76b0bd879878d3d61f468862",
      "old_mode": 33188,
      "old_path": "api/handler.go",
      "new_id": "2e6b9cc9435433587ca5d5dc926ce748cb7b8017",
      "new_mode": 33188,
      "new_path": "api/handler.go"
    },
    {
      "type": "modify",
      "old_id": "af87ec7283761d41f1d3ac78fb7d1d044bdc411b",
      "old_mode": 33188,
      "old_path": "client/main.go",
      "new_id": "8d8ea4c2353dae4fef26f26dca3174177985606f",
      "new_mode": 33188,
      "new_path": "client/main.go"
    },
    {
      "type": "modify",
      "old_id": "2148cc9daf9a4910b3563e61f39af1a321c077f8",
      "old_mode": 33188,
      "old_path": "cmd/AbstractOLT/AbstractOLT.go",
      "new_id": "eee3b0f28528bea31ceebd8e354575adb1325171",
      "new_mode": 33188,
      "new_path": "cmd/AbstractOLT/AbstractOLT.go"
    },
    {
      "type": "delete",
      "old_id": "6e947a50c2b01cfb305c2cc943554720b29f54ad",
      "old_mode": 33188,
      "old_path": "internal/pkg/chassisSerialize/serialize.go",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    },
    {
      "type": "modify",
      "old_id": "ef8419f904ad4feeda75bce92a6a9cac16d401a0",
      "old_mode": 33188,
      "old_path": "internal/pkg/settings/Settings_test.go",
      "new_id": "84dca73187945549206b62bdf186d476c5043bd2",
      "new_mode": 33188,
      "new_path": "internal/pkg/settings/Settings_test.go"
    },
    {
      "type": "modify",
      "old_id": "5e38890a1fc66c84a20cfe6c476229774c28a506",
      "old_mode": 33188,
      "old_path": "models/abstract/ChassisUtils.go",
      "new_id": "0cacf79f7e8414d4c62674d39c6c19cf4862d64a",
      "new_mode": 33188,
      "new_path": "models/abstract/ChassisUtils.go"
    },
    {
      "type": "modify",
      "old_id": "06e0002f2e9987dda810f04dfd026919a40b41e1",
      "old_mode": 33188,
      "old_path": "models/abstract/chassis.go",
      "new_id": "9b62c8c819bffa92d5a510ec42e8ac97050bbb58",
      "new_mode": 33188,
      "new_path": "models/abstract/chassis.go"
    },
    {
      "type": "modify",
      "old_id": "e626e7c6704aa8eb2f4644f22c6f59d363c8897b",
      "old_mode": 33188,
      "old_path": "models/abstract/port.go",
      "new_id": "1af3d6e959c7ea6db1d469d596639d542bdeab8d",
      "new_mode": 33188,
      "new_path": "models/abstract/port.go"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"8781d2dd71de421a8a42de11e43d5a9a57c64f1e",
      "new_mode": 33188,
      "new_path": "models/abstract/serialize.go"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"142c5fa4e59b40c85662b223c888d6b64dac6f92",
      "new_mode": 33188,
      "new_path": "models/chassisHolder.go"
    },
    {
      "type": "modify",
      "old_id": "65e552df65517cfe5445a5a14be9617e508bd91f",
      "old_mode": 33188,
      "old_path": "models/chassisMap.go",
      "new_id": "a4c04b016259ff4944fda5327043fc7e404b2b8e",
      "new_mode": 33188,
      "new_path": "models/chassisMap.go"
    },
    {
      "type": "modify",
      "old_id": "7b30eeb470b61d07cc7249cab347c04fd7e7b1c6",
      "old_mode": 33188,
      "old_path": "models/chassisMap_test.go",
      "new_id": "f1e5d359f61c582f9f497fed7d6f4bb46b52fe08",
      "new_mode": 33188,
      "new_path": "models/chassisMap_test.go"
    },
    {
      "type": "modify",
      "old_id": "5fb9a94dab9791f5462287796b4d6311d7c20212",
      "old_mode": 33188,
      "old_path": "models/physical/chassis.go",
      "new_id": "4392a10d562d45df51b88c17117d12f62dba4991",
      "new_mode": 33188,
      "new_path": "models/physical/chassis.go"
    },
    {
      "type": "modify",
      "old_id": "cded2dc04163f516c90fe1f6afd8c5ac0f275c2e",
      "old_mode": 33188,
      "old_path": "models/physical/edgecore.go",
      "new_id": "0cf4479c7005eab93ed1b4eaedce5ad47ef6ca45",
      "new_mode": 33188,
      "new_path": "models/physical/edgecore.go"
    },
    {
      "type": "modify",
      "old_id": "a7fbf68850447c8db95591171f399571945fd28c",
      "old_mode": 33188,
      "old_path": "models/physical/edgecore_test.go",
      "new_id": "c4a06df2c99fc33afb9812602dad3bec6bcc20b0",
      "new_mode": 33188,
      "new_path": "models/physical/edgecore_test.go"
    },
    {
      "type": "modify",
      "old_id": "121fdac2e7ca49e12431bc220da45b8629968c3c",
      "old_mode": 33188,
      "old_path": "models/physical/olt.go",
      "new_id": "721e731b9f48cc97f5e17e679ce3059c6b5d9f6e",
      "new_mode": 33188,
      "new_path": "models/physical/olt.go"
    },
    {
      "type": "modify",
      "old_id": "ca321fdb0463b40a3b252a0bfea10a9a0dddd3bf",
      "old_mode": 33188,
      "old_path": "models/physical/ponport.go",
      "new_id": "683489e6a807ed34734fc84eb2bc04f5828f3de9",
      "new_mode": 33188,
      "new_path": "models/physical/ponport.go"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"a0c2a01a8c179255932a4a8283ad3a7a0e39fcbf",
      "new_mode": 33188,
      "new_path": "models/serialize.go"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"aaca6ec137ae096bbdd9a19ea56d9cbba064a5d1",
      "new_mode": 33188,
      "new_path": "models/serialize_test.go"
    },
    {
      "type": "modify",
      "old_id": "00058001c8c49389be1c81a080e7ca9d024c060d",
      "old_mode": 33188,
      "old_path": "models/tosca/addOlt.go",
      "new_id": "30e8d1211e40b0b14b90036d2600f495fb64a35e",
      "new_mode": 33188,
      "new_path": "models/tosca/addOlt.go"
    },
    {
      "type": "modify",
      "old_id": "1b2f6676dfa4e6d23dda3cf7fdf83fd976f29cf2",
      "old_mode": 33188,
      "old_path": "models/tosca/addOlt_test.go",
      "new_id": "89612138ceec97da5165be4ab2ed1583f1926cf4",
      "new_mode": 33188,
      "new_path": "models/tosca/addOlt_test.go"
    },
    {
      "type": "modify",
      "old_id": "0d4834082d400034ff974005c3405886189f53a2",
      "old_mode": 33188,
      "old_path": "models/tosca/addSubscriber_test.go",
      "new_id": "36b6acf5a822cb05cabdef275d477980ba98e147",
      "new_mode": 33188,
      "new_path": "models/tosca/addSubscriber_test.go"
    },
    {
      "type": "modify",
      "old_id": "c83cc4d939c61dfb7d142c0d0ecaad0838bf13d1",
      "old_mode": 33188,
      "old_path": "models/tosca/provisionOnt.go",
      "new_id": "e94c435ce27d7877d457591fe381fad5c2cd3675",
      "new_mode": 33188,
      "new_path": "models/tosca/provisionOnt.go"
    },
    {
      "type": "modify",
      "old_id": "ff7cd8580dba06d05ca16260dda93791d0d6459e",
      "old_mode": 33188,
      "old_path": "models/tosca/provisionOnt_test.go",
      "new_id": "8ce744619d7780752418a0af9489f98e7cfdc2e2",
      "new_mode": 33188,
      "new_path": "models/tosca/provisionOnt_test.go"
    },
    {
      "type": "delete",
      "old_id": "52a1348fb0a34742b07899e04c5829d9f908c0a8",
      "old_mode": 33188,
      "old_path": "test/integration/TestUtils.go",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    },
    {
      "type": "delete",
      "old_id": "c1524bb3bd82b3d3196a6763d29af3c009aa2c86",
      "old_mode": 33188,
      "old_path": "test/integration/serialize_test.go",
      "new_id": "0000000000000000000000000000000000000000",
      "new_mode": 0,
      "new_path": "/dev/null"
    }
  ]
}
